1 FINDING FACTORS Students will learn/discover: The meaning of the term factors How to find all the factors of numbers How to make models of factor families Vocabulary: Factors: Factors are numbers you can multiply together to get another number. Example: 2 and 3 are factors of 6; 2 and 4 are factors of 8. SUGGESTED BRICKS Size Number 1x1 20 1x2 6-8 1x4 4-6 1x16 2 2x2 4-6 2x4 9-12 2x8 2 Note: Using a base plate will help keep the bricks in a uniform line. One base plate is suggested for these activities. Why is this important? Students need to be able to identify all the factors of numbers before they can work on Least Common Multiples and Greatest Common Factors. Understanding the link between multiplication facts and division facts is crucial for students to prepare for upper levels of math, such as fractions. Knowing fact families and factors will help when learning to multiply larger numbers and will help with understanding division, which is often taught simultaneously with multiplication. Brick Math journal: After students build their models, have them draw the models on base plate paper and keep them in their Brick Math journals (see page 7 more about the Brick Math journal). Recording the models on paper after building with the LEGO bricks helps reinforce the concepts. DR. SHIRLEY DISSELER TEACHING MULTIPLICATION USING LEGO BRICKS 9

Part 1: Show Them How Model how to find all the factors of 16 1. Place a 2x8 brick or a 1x16 brick on a base plate. 2. Place two bricks that are the same and, when placed next to the 16-stud brick, are equivalent in size and show two halves of the 16-stud brick. Use two 2x4 bricks or two 1x8 bricks. 3. Ask students: Can you find three bricks of equal size equivalent to the size of the 16-stud brick? Let students look and think, and discover that the answer is no. 4. Ask students: Can you find four bricks of equal size equivalent to the size of the 16-stud brick? Let students look and think, and discover that the answer is four 2x2 bricks or four 1x4 bricks. 5. Ask students: Can you find the next number of equal-sized bricks that are equivalent to the size of the 16-stud brick? Let students discover that five, six, and seven bricks don t work. Let them discover that the answer is eight 1x2 bricks. 10 TEACHING MULTIPLICATION USING LEGO BRICKS DR. SHIRLEY DISSELER

6. Ask students: Can you find the next number of equal-sized bricks that are equivalent to the size of the 16-stud brick? Let students discover that the answer is sixteen 1x1 bricks. 7. Name all the factors of 16 by looking at the LEGO bricks on the base plate. Answer: 16, 8, 4, 2, and 1. Part 2: Show What You Know 1. Can you build a model to show all the factors of 6? Solution A: This model is a possible solution, showing factors 6, 3, 2, and 1. Solution B: This model uses a different combination of bricks. Students who create this model could also explain that there are 2 sets of 3 in 6, and 3 sets of 2 in 6. DR. SHIRLEY DISSELER TEACHING MULTIPLICATION USING LEGO BRICKS 11

For example, when learning/discussing fact families, I have witnessed many students blindly memorizing the facts without truly understanding why there is a relationship between the facts. By using different sizes of LEGO bricks in one of the activities in this book, students are able to build and then observe a visual representation of the fact families. The students are able to see that one 1x6 brick contains the same number of studs as two 1x3 bricks. In my experience as an educator, students tend to deeply grasp a concept whenever they are fully immersed in the learning process. The activities in this book require students to think critically about the process of multiplication that so often becomes robotic. Teaching Multiplication Using LEGO Bricks covers multiplication processes such as: bundling, repeated addition, using place value, using array models, one-to-one correspondence, and more. Rather than blindly following a set of steps, students are able to build and think critically about what is happening as the problem evolves.
